在VSCode中編寫和測試SQL代碼的技巧

vscode中編寫和測試sql代碼可以通過安裝sqltools和sql server (mssql)插件實現。1. 在擴展市場中安裝插件。2. 配置數據庫連接,編輯settings.json文件。3. 利用語法高亮和自動補全編寫sql代碼。4. 使用快捷鍵如ctrl + /和shift + alt + f提高效率。5. 通過右鍵選擇execute query測試sql查詢。6. 使用explain命令優化查詢性能。

在VSCode中編寫和測試SQL代碼的技巧

vscode中編寫和測試SQL代碼,不僅能提高你的開發效率,還能讓你的SQL查詢變得更加精準和高效。那么,如何在VSCode中充分利用這些功能呢?讓我來分享一些我自己在實際項目中積累的技巧和經驗。

首先要說的是,VSCode本身并不直接支持SQL的執行和測試,但通過一些擴展插件,我們可以把它變成一個強大的SQL開發環境。我最常用的插件是SQLTools和SQL Server (mssql)。這些插件不僅能提供語法高亮和代碼自動補全,還能讓你直接在VSCode中連接到數據庫,執行SQL查詢,并查看結果。

要安裝這些插件,只需在VSCode的擴展市場中搜索并安裝即可。安裝好后,你需要配置你的數據庫連接,這通常可以通過編輯settings.json文件來完成。例如:

{     "sqltools.connections": [         {             "previewLimit": 50,             "driver": "SQLite",             "name": "My SQLite",             "database": "${workspaceFolder}/mydatabase.db"         }     ] }

配置好連接后,你就可以開始編寫SQL代碼了。VSCode會根據你選擇的數據庫類型提供相應的語法高亮和自動補全,這大大提高了編寫SQL代碼的效率。

在編寫SQL代碼時,我喜歡使用一些快捷鍵來提高效率。比如,Ctrl + /可以快速注釋或取消注釋選中的代碼,這在調試SQL查詢時非常有用。另外,Shift + Alt + F可以格式化你的SQL代碼,讓它看起來更加整潔和易讀。

當你編寫好SQL查詢后,如何測試它呢?這時候SQLTools就派上用場了。你可以選中你的SQL代碼,然后點擊右鍵,選擇Execute Query。執行結果會顯示在一個新的窗口中,這樣你就可以實時查看查詢結果了。

在實際項目中,我發現一個常見的錯誤是沒有充分利用索引。索引可以大大提高查詢的性能,但在VSCode中,你可以通過執行EXPLaiN命令來查看你的查詢計劃,從而優化你的SQL代碼。例如:

EXPLAIN SELECT * FROM users WHERE age > 30;

這個命令會顯示查詢計劃,幫助你理解數據庫是如何執行這個查詢的,從而找到可能的優化點。

當然,使用VSCode編寫和測試SQL代碼也有一些需要注意的地方。首先是安全性問題。在連接數據庫時,確保你的連接字符串和密碼是安全的,不要將敏感信息直接寫在代碼中。其次是性能問題。在執行大型查詢時,可能會導致VSCode變得非常慢,這時候你可能需要考慮在數據庫管理工具中執行這些查詢。

總的來說,在VSCode中編寫和測試SQL代碼是一個非常靈活和高效的過程。通過利用合適的插件和快捷鍵,你可以大大提高你的開發效率。希望這些技巧和經驗能幫助你在實際項目中更好地使用VSCode來處理SQL代碼。

? 版權聲明
THE END
喜歡就支持一下吧
點贊15 分享